>There's virtually no documentation, so I'd have to trace through their code to figure anything out. They have a rich set of extended properties and methods, but only cursory description of what they're for. (VMF is well-documented).
>
>They had no support for remote views (I don't know if they've fixed this in a later version).
>
>I find VMF to be much more robust than VE, but again that might be because I missed some of VE's features due to poor documentation.
>
>(I used VE for six months, VMF for three)
